In 2015, PepsiCo Australia & New Zealand implemented SAP ERP ECC 6.0 for ERP Financial. The SAP ERP ECC 6.0 deployment centralized core financial processes including general ledger, accounts payable, accounts receivable, tax posting, and trade spend accounting to support finance and commercial reporting for the ANZ business.
Operational coverage included the Trade Promotions Team based in Sydney, with direct data stewardship for Grocery, Impulse, and Wholesale promotional programs where a Sales Administrator managed promotions data entry, claim validation, reconciliation, and stakeholder coordination. The implementation operated alongside trade promotion management tools and BI reporting components, with SAP ERP ECC 6.0 used as the financial posting and reporting backbone in the promotions data lifecycle, and governance embedded in daily interaction between Trade Promotions and Grocery/Impulse account teams to enforce data validation and reconciliation workflows.

In 2016, PepsiCo Australia & New Zealand implemented Infinite BrassRing ( Formerly IBM Kenexa BrassRing ) as an Applicant Tracking System. The deployment is delivered via Infinite Computer Solutions and is directly exposed on the corporate careers site job detail pages.
The Infinite BrassRing ( Formerly IBM Kenexa BrassRing ) Applicant Tracking System was configured to support core talent acquisition workflows, including job requisition creation, public job posting, candidate application intake, resume parsing, interview scheduling, and offer management. Configuration emphasis was on career site integration and the candidate portal to present branded job detail pages and manage applicant touchpoints.
Operational coverage for the ATS is the HR and Talent Acquisition functions across PepsiCo Australia & New Zealand, surfacing open roles through the BrassRing job detail URLs on the public careers site. The implementation establishes a web-accessible recruitment layer that consolidates requisitions and candidate records for regional hiring activity.
Governance focused on centralizing recruitment processes and requisition approval workflows to provide a single system of record for candidate lifecycle management within the Australia and New Zealand region. The configuration and operational model align the Applicant Tracking System with enterprise hiring practices and career site publishing.

In 2020, PepsiCo Australia & New Zealand implemented Telerik Sitefinity CMS. Telerik Sitefinity CMS is deployed as the Web Content Management platform powering the company website for Australia and New Zealand. The implementation centralizes content publishing for regional brand pages and corporate communications across the ANZ footprint.
The implementation leverages core Web Content Management capabilities including template-driven page composition, content authoring and approval workflows, digital asset management, multilingual localization support, and role-based permissions for editorial teams. Configured modules include reusable widgets and structured content types to support campaign pages, news feeds, and media-rich assets, aligning with marketing content operations.
Operational ownership rests with marketing and digital channels teams who manage editorial workflows, content staging, publishing schedules, and a centralized taxonomy for localized content. The deployment is focused on the public-facing site, providing a single CMS instance to coordinate content governance and editorial control across Australia and New Zealand.
